On Saturday 15 November the WICKED Company, including Amanda Harrison and Lucy Durack, opened the Myer Christmas Parade with a performance of “One Short Day.” The routine was specially choreographed for this performance, and was staged in front of the famous Myer Christmas windows. The song was received by rounds of applause from the vast crowd that had gathered for the Parade in Melbourne’s Bourke Street Mall. The performance was broadcast on Channel 7 at 6:30pm that evening and will be aired again in the week leading up to Christmas.
